Safer Internet Day in P3SG

9th Feb 2023

As part of Internet Safety Day we looked at different ways in which we can stay safe online. We watched a video called ‘Jessie and Friends’ which was all about not sharing photographs and we read a story called ‘Digiduck Saves the Day’ which was about positive ways to use the internet. We also discussed the importance of not sharing personal information online and discussed who our trusted adults would be if we saw something that upset us online. We have all learned lots about staying safe online.
